A lot of people around here have covers made for their
boats that will go around the front deck or a rear deck,
custom made of fabric and heavy flexible clear plastic
sown together, and it usually snaps and zippers in place. I
don't know what to call them. What I'm mainly interested
in is the plastic. Can anyone tell me some specifics about
it so I have an idea what to look for, and maybe even
where to get it?



Ask around for someone who does "boat canvas" - they will have, or
know where to get, that plastic.

You might also look in the Yellow Pages under "Plastic" for suppliers
of plastic sheet and other materials.




Shops that do custom convertible top replacements are another source of
high quality flexible clear plastic.

Most of the larger pieces are "clear flexible vinyl", UV treated or
resistant. .012" thick, 54" wide on rolls at the local fabric store. The
..04 or .040" referred to would be a high quality "press polished" sheet,
about 20" x 40". This would be available from a plastics distributor (if
they will sell a small quantity).
If you want to DIY these are the routes to go. Otherwise, try auto/marine
upholstery, tent & awning, or canvas shops.
